  • Canon made a TV commercial campaign on national networks featuring world-renowned athletes, such as tennis player John Newcombe, diver Jennifer Chandler, and golfer Ben Crenshaw

 

  • Canon was first called Kwanon.

 

  • There were five different logos before the current one.

 

  • Canon’s first camera’s lens was made by Nikon, its main rival camera company.

 

  • Over one million Canon AE-1s were sold.

 

  • No SLR (single-lens reflex) camera has sold as many as the Canon AE-1.

 

  • Canon has been awarded Most Trusted Camera Brand for 11 consecutive years.

 

  • Kwanon, Canon’s original name, is the Buddhist goddess of mercy. The engineers hoped this would make her share her benevolence as they pursued their dream of making the world's finest cameras. 

 

  • This symbol was engraved on each Kwanon to represent the goddess of mercy.

 

  • Canon’s first camera turned 80 in 2014.

 

  • Plastic was used to make many of Canon’s cameras but was disguised so no one would know.

 

  • The lens of the Kwanon was named Kasyapa, after Mahakasyapa, a disciple of the Buddha.

 

  • Many of the Hewlett-Packard (HP) laser printers are made by Canon but sold by HP under their name since 1985.

 

  • Canon manufactures in the United States, Germany, France, Taiwan, China, Malaysia, Thailand, and Vietnam along with a manufacturing joint venture in Korea.

 

  • Canon is an American translation of Kwanon.

 

  • Canon’s first time making a non-optical product was in 1933 when they made a calculater.

 

  • The Canon AE-1 was the world’s first camera with an embedded microcomputer.

 

  • All Canon AE-1 commercials had a slogan that says, “So advanced, it’s simple” at the end.

 

  • The concept of the AE-1 was that anyone can take a professional photo because it was so easy to use.
